PEI Wildlife Rescue & Rehabilitation Inc. is a charitable organization based in Miscouche, Prince Edward Island, classified by the CRA under animal welfare. In its fiscal year ending May 31, 2024, it reported $30K in revenue and $20K in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 90% from donations, 10% from other charities. In 2024, 5 other registered charities reported granting it a combined $3,010.

Compared with 430 animal-welfare char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 56% of peers.

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 5 names.
